5 Tools to Save Web Pages For Reading Later

Posted: 29 Jun 2014 06:11 AM PDT

“Life’s adventures make great reading!” – Denise Robbins

It is not uncommon for authors to allow their stories to be read online for free but downloadable versions are made available for a price. One of the biggest drawback with this free version is that it is dependent on an Internet connection. No internet, no reading. This is where online tools which allow you to save online pages for offline reading come into the picture, giving you more freedom on how you want to read them.
